What you will do:

Provide exceptional customer service to internal and external stakeholders who are seeking support and information relevant to Accounts Payable & Accounts Receivables business areas, or redirecting as appropriate
Effectively and professionally manage a high volume of mail in a variety of formats
Respond to inquiries, primarily through phone and email channels, in a prompt and professional manner
Perform general administration functions such as departmental correspondence, data entry/review, filing, and ordering office supplies
Support a variety of projects within Accounts Payable & Accounts Receivable, which requires a flexible and collaborative approach and desire to add value  
Learn quickly and share accurate information with departmental leaders and employees upon inquiry
What you will bring:

Demonstrated self-motivation, analytical, problem solving skills and initiative to achieve desired outcomes
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ously with strong results and goal orientation
Strong interpersonal and communication skills; comfortable working with both internal and external stakeholders in a multi-tasking, deadline oriented, team environment.
The successful candidate will have graduated from an administrative assistant or similar program at a recognized business college supplemented by a minimum of two years related experience.  Education and experience equivalencies may be considered.
Excellent communication skills, including the ability to write clearly and succinctly in a variety of communication settings and styles
Strong customer-service orientation
Ability to troubleshoot and respond to client inquiries by phone and email
Proficiency in Microsoft Office or equivalent word processing and computing programs
